ホームページ >バックエンド開発 >Python チュートリアル >ガニコーンにフラスコをデプロイする方法
Gunicorn が Flask アプリケーションをデプロイする手順は次のとおりです: 1. ターミナルまたはコマンド ラインに「pip install gunicorn」コマンドを入力して Gunicorn をインストールします。2. Flask アプリケーションを作成します。3. 「」と入力します。ターミナルまたはコマンド ラインで「flask run」コマンドを実行し、Flask アプリケーションを開始します。 4. ターミナルまたはコマンド ラインで「gunicorn app:app」コマンドを入力し、Gunicorn を使用して Flask アプリケーションをデプロイします。 5. Gunicorn 構成を調整します。
# このチュートリアルのオペレーティング システム: Windows 10 システム、Dell G3 コンピューター。
Gunicorn は、Flask アプリケーションのデプロイに使用できる Python WSGI HTTP サーバーです。 Gunicorn を使用して Flask アプリをデプロイする手順は次のとおりです:
pip install gunicorn
from flask import Flask app = Flask(__name__) @app.route('/') def hello(): return 'Hello, World!'
flask run
すべてが正常な場合ブラウザで http://localhost:5000/ にアクセスすると、「Hello, World!」の出力が表示されます。
gunicorn app:app
ここで、最初のアプリは Python を表します。 file は Flask アプリケーションの変数名を定義し、2 番目の app は Flask アプリケーション オブジェクトの名前を表します。すべてがうまくいけば、Gunicorn が起動し、ポート 8000 (デフォルト値) でリッスンします。ブラウザで http://localhost:8000/ にアクセスすると、「Hello, World!」の出力が表示されます。
gunicorn app:app --bind 0.0.0.0:8080
これにより、Gunicorn はポート 8080 でリッスンし、外部ネットワーク アクセスが許可されます。
上記は、Gunicorn を使用して Flask アプリケーションをデプロイする手順です。 Gunicorn の構成をニーズに合わせて調整して、アプリケーションのニーズをより適切に満たすことができます。
以上がガニコーンにフラスコをデプロイする方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。